Bishop Rock Capital's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Bishop Rock Capital held 35 positions worth $252M, down 25% from $335M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 59% of the portfolio.

Bishop Rock Capital withdrew a net $59.9M in Q1 2022, closing 7 positions and reducing 18 holdings. Its most notable exit was TransUnion, an estimated $4.31M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 39% of assets, up from 36%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.

Against the trend, Bishop Rock Capital opened a new position in Danaher worth $8.25M.
